The members of 20 Essex have announced that Andrew Fulton will be joining chambers in March.

His practice in recent years has focused on capital markets, derivatives and structured products.

Iain Milligan QC, head of chambers says: “Andrew’s arrival will add to our expertise in derivatives and complement the general commercial work undertaken by our members. We have no doubt his addition to our membership will be welcomed by our clients.”
